Role: EMEA Talent Partner (Fixed Term Contract) 

Location: Warsaw, Poland

 

ROLE MISSION

Working in partnership with our client, the EMEA Talent Partner will support our business to hire and build the best teams across several European markets.  

 

THIS ROLE IS RIGHT FOR YOU IF...

You have proven experience in recruiting throughout EMEA. Experience across the Netherlands, France, and Germany would be a huge bonus!  You will be a self-starter, with a real focus on finding the best talent in the industry, be comfortable with working at pace and most of all be a team player who takes pride in all they do. 

 

ABOUT THE TEAM YOU WILL BE JOINING

The People Team has 40+ people globally all working to deliver our mission of building the best teams in the world. We are a friendly bunch that love dogs, collaborating and learning together.  

 

WHAT YOU WILL BE DOING IN YOUR ROLE

  • Leading the way, owning and overseeing all hires for your area. 
  • Working with your internal stakeholders to source and retain top talent in the industry. Creating a clear view on what type of talent best suits each of our sites. 
  • Managing all aspects of the hiring process for a range of vacancies across a variety of levels, locations and skill sets, and with the best talent. 
  • Acting as a business partner to your stakeholders to manage expectations, educating on the recruitment process, time frames and talent. 
  • Proactively spearheading the evolution of our recruitment processes with and ways of working to ensure we our industry leaders, including by not limited to artificial intelligence led recruiting, EVP, and social media targeting. 
  • Owning the candidate journey end to end. 
  • Owning the candidate brand engagement.
  • Managing candidate communications efficiently and empathetically, whether candidates are successful or unsuccessful with their applications. 

WHAT SKILLS WILL HELP YOU BE SUCCESSFUL 

  • Experience of hiring exceptional talent within a fast-paced, international business environment – experience of working within a marketing agency would be beneficial but not essential. 
  • A passion and proven track record for finding the right people for the right roles using various “direct recruitment’ tools and methodologies 
  • Strong attention to detail under pressure and working with high volumes 
  • Desire to ensure both positive candidate and stakeholder experiences at all times. 
  • You must be a team player 
  • Experience of recruiting in multiple European markets.
